Output 6589d0491cb519985914e1b8bf1cc6c0b1844c3bfb922a49b1e8e6fee8f0debe:0

value
751472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ef0bf95519d430ff21b724510fb7457c08cb65e OP_EQUAL
address
3Qw1xkxxpXV5BTEpsdYdSvxqjk5wp47H1T
transaction
6589d0491cb519985914e1b8bf1cc6c0b1844c3bfb922a49b1e8e6fee8f0debe